Transaction 012d6f16003d1e80d353e6fa9b67c1aff26c8206df7d2cd6c9f05e10eb795a2e

21 Input
1 Outputs
  • 012d6f16003d1e80d353e6fa9b67c1aff26c8206df7d2cd6c9f05e10eb795a2e:0
  • value  58957645
    address  33o3NUAy3EVUqmSAumqREYegVNSfAfpEZ2